The US made three critical decisions in WW2: entering the war, internment of Japanese-Americans, and dropping atomic bombs.
Counterarguments include isolationism, racial discrimination, and the ethical dilemma of using nuclear weapons.
1. Entering the war: A counterargument is that the US should have remained isolated, focusing on domestic issues rather than intervening in foreign conflicts. The rebuttal is that the US had a moral obligation to help its allies and prevent the spread of fascism and genocide.
2. Internment of Japanese-Americans: Critics argue that this decision was racially discriminatory and a violation of civil rights. They claim it was based on unfounded fears of espionage and sabotage. The rebuttal is that the US government believed it was a necessary security measure to protect the country during wartime.
3. Dropping atomic bombs: The counterargument is that the use of nuclear weapons on Hiroshima and Nagasaki was morally unjustifiable and caused unnecessary suffering. The rebuttal is that the bombings saved countless lives by bringing about a swift end to the war and preventing a costly invasion of Japan.

1. The Four Modernizations: Deng Xiaoping's Four Modernizations initiative focused on modernizing China's agriculture, industry, science and technology, and defense. This was a major part of his economic reform agenda, which sought to improve China's economic and technological progress.
2. Open Door Policy: Deng Xiaoping implemented China's Open Door Policy in 1978, which opened the country up to foreign investment and increased economic ties with other countries. This policy allowed for the influx of foreign capital and technology and helped to spur economic growth in China.
3. Special Economic Zones: Deng Xiaoping established several Special Economic Zones to encourage foreign investment, technology transfer, and economic growth. These zones provided a haven for foreign investors and allowed for the development of a more open and market-based economy.
4. Mixed Economy: Deng Xiaoping implemented a mixed economy in China, which blended elements of a market economy with a planned economy. This allowed for the development of different sectors of the economy while maintaining the government's control over the economy.

The Mahabharata, one of the ancient Indian epics, features a vast array of characters, each with their unique personalities and traits. While many characters in the Mahabharata exhibit virtuous qualities, there are some who display negative attitudes or attributes. Here are a few notable examples:
1. Duryodhana: Duryodhana is often depicted as the main antagonist of the Mahabharata. He is known for his jealousy, arrogance, and deceitful nature. Duryodhana's intense desire for power and his refusal to acknowledge the rightful claims of the Pandavas contribute to his negative portrayal.
2. Shakuni: Shakuni, Duryodhana's maternal uncle, is a cunning and manipulative character. He is driven by a deep hatred for the Pandavas and employs deceitful tactics, such as gambling, to further his agenda. Shakuni's scheming nature and his role in instigating the Kurukshetra war highlight his negative attributes.
3. Karna: Although Karna is often praised for his loyalty and valor, his negative attributes stem from his association with Duryodhana. Karna's unwavering support for Duryodhana, despite knowing his wrongful actions, showcases his blind loyalty and misplaced priorities.
4. Dronacharya: Dronacharya, the royal teacher of the Kuru princes, displays negative traits in his favoritism towards the Kauravas. His bias and willingness to bend the rules during the Kurukshetra war for the benefit of his favorite students reflect a lack of impartiality and ethical conduct.
5. Dhritarashtra: Dhritarashtra, the blind king and father of the Kauravas, exhibits a negative attitude through his inability to control his sons and make just decisions. His excessive attachment to his own children and his failure to address their wrongdoings contribute to the tragic events of the epic.

As a result of the decision in Brown v. Board of Education, racial segregation in public schools was prohibited in Texas.
This landmark Supreme Court case ruled that the segregation of schools based on race was unconstitutional, marking a significant milestone in the Civil Rights Movement and leading to the desegregation of schools across the United States.
The decision in Brown v. Board of Education, handed down by the Supreme Court in 1954, declared that the doctrine of "separate but equal" in public education was inherently unequal and violated the Fourteenth Amendment's guarantee of equal protection under the law. This ruling directly impacted public schools in Texas, along with the rest of the country, by prohibiting racial segregation in educational institutions.
The decision in Brown v. Board of Education marked a significant turning point in the fight against racial discrimination and paved the way for the desegregation of schools. It dismantled the legal basis for racial segregation and challenged the notion that separate facilities for different races could ever be truly equal. As a result, public schools in Texas and throughout the United States were required to integrate and provide equal educational opportunities for all students, regardless of their race or ethnicity.

Cahokia and Teotihuacán are two ancient civilizations that have left behind fascinating archaeological sites, yet they still hold many mysteries and unanswered questions. Here are some of the mysteries surrounding Cahokia and Teotihuacán:
1. Cahokia:
Cahokia, located near present-day St. Louis, Missouri, was once the largest city in North America during the Mississippian culture (900-1500 CE). Despite its prominence, there are still enigmatic aspects of Cahokia's civilization. One mystery revolves around the purpose and function of the massive earthen mounds found at the site. These mounds, such as Monk's Mound, were monumental structures that served various purposes, including ceremonial, residential, and administrative. However, the exact rituals and activities conducted on these mounds remain uncertain.
Another mystery is the decline and abandonment of Cahokia. By the 14th century, the city's population dwindled, and it was eventually abandoned. The reasons behind this decline are still debated among scholars. Possible factors include environmental changes, political instability, social conflicts, or the spread of diseases. Unraveling the specific causes of Cahokia's decline would shed light on the factors that shaped the fate of this once-thriving civilization.
2. Teotihuacán:
Teotihuacán, located near modern-day Mexico City, was one of the largest and most influential cities in ancient Mesoamerica. Its monumental architecture, including the Pyramid of the Sun and the Pyramid of the Moon, reflects the city's grandeur. However, much about Teotihuacán remains a mystery. One enigma is the identity of its rulers and the nature of its political organization. Despite extensive archaeological research, no clear evidence of kings or a centralized ruling system has been found.
Another mystery is the purpose and symbolism behind the elaborate murals and iconography found throughout the city. The meanings behind the intricate frescoes and carvings are still not fully understood, leaving room for interpretation and speculation.
Additionally, the collapse of Teotihuacán is another unresolved mystery. Around the 7th century CE, the city experienced a decline and eventual abandonment. The causes of this collapse, such as social unrest, environmental factors, or external invasions, are still subjects of ongoing research and debate.
Studying and uncovering the mysteries of Cahokia and Teotihuacán is an ongoing endeavor that involves archaeological investigations, interdisciplinary research, and the analysis of cultural and historical contexts. By piecing together the fragments of these ancient civilizations, we can gain a deeper understanding of their complexities and the factors that shaped their rise and fall

A tartan is a design made up of intersecting bands of various colors that run horizontally and vertically. Wool was originally used to weave tartans, although today many other materials are used. Scotland is strongly connected to tartan.
Tartan designs are nearly universally found on Scottish kilts. In North America, tartan is frequently referred to as plaid, however, in Scotland, a flannel is a tartan cloth worn as a kilt item or a simple blanket used on a bed.
Tartan is created by weaving warp and weft threads at right angles to one another to create alternate bands of colorful (pre-dyed) material. Simple twill is used to weave the weft, moving one thread every pass while weaving two above and two under the warp. This creates observable diagonal lines where several hues intersect, giving the impression that new colors have been created by blending the existing ones. The resultant color blocks repeat both vertically and horizontally in a recognizable square and line pattern known as a sett.
